Pho (Various Types)
Soup
Pho is a Vietnamese noodle soup consisting of broth, rice noodles, herbs, and meat (usually beef or chicken). Pho Thuy Duong likely offers various options, including Pho Tai (rare beef), Pho Ga (chicken), and Pho Bo (beef).
